Hegel's Philosophy of Freedom

  • Paul Franco

0

0 ratings

"Human freedom is the central theme of modern political philosophy, and G. W. F. Hegel offers perhaps the most profound and systematic modern attempt to understand the state as the realization of human freedom. In this comprehensive examination of Hegel's philosophy of freedom, Paul Franco traces the development of Hegel's ideas of freedom, situates them within his general philosophical system, and relates them to the larger tradition of modern political philosophy.

Franco then applies Hegel's understanding of liberty to certain problems in contemporary political theory."--BOOK JACKET.
